“Never give up the opportunity to say something great about your space. This is a mind-set that we have taken on, and it has made a huge impact. It doesn’t matter if it happens in a store, gas station, another community, print media, or social media. If we see a chance to shout about the great things happening in our space, we do.
The first step is getting in a mind-set to ensure that the positives can be shared in all areas. From messages on phones to email signatures to ending interviews with school mottoes, if you get the opportunity to talk about it, talk about it.”
